“Human” in a MOTS-c catalog title ordinarily describes the referenced peptide sequence; it does not mean the material was isolated from a human donor, tested in humans or approved for human use.

What the record shows

  • The core efficacy literature remains cell- and animal-based.
  • FDA says it has not identified human exposure data for drug products containing MOTS-c.
  • The word “human” must not be presented as a clinical-use signal.

The identity and evidence boundary

Mitochondrial genetic notation is unusually easy to oversimplify. The sequence should be stated directly, with any terminal modification or counterion, rather than relying on the word “human.”

FDA also identifies immunogenicity, impurity and API-characterization concerns. Those gaps are reasons to narrow claims, not to fill them with anecdotes.

Editorial rule

Use the exact intervention name, model, population and endpoint from the cited record. Do not convert an association, mechanism, animal result, approved finished-drug record or analytical test into a claim about an unrelated catalog lot.
